Internet drives soaring patient complaints - Best Doctors

clock

The internet has been a "big influencer" in higher patient expectations, Best Doctors has stated.

The medical opinion provider has seen a sustained increase in the number of cases it has handled in the last two years.

Dominic Howard, director at Best Doctors, Europe, said: "There is no doubt that patients have higher expectations and are prepared to go and get more information about their condition, diagnosis and treatment options in order to make the best decisions.

"The internet has been a big influencer. It is not surprising that our research shows that 89% of people would go online to seek more information following a diagnosis."

It follows on from a 23% rise in patient complaints reported to the General Medical Council in the past year; in line with the complaints trend that has soared by 69% in three years.

Best Doctors added that "interestingly" the regulator had said there was no evidence to suggest care was getting worse but rather greater expectations were driving the trend.
